I'm currently configuring an OpenVPN client on an arm microprocessor running debian squeeze, however I'm running into problems.

As the below shows, /dev/net/tun exists:

debarm:~# whoami
root
debarm:~# cd /dev/net
debarm:/dev/net# ls -lah
total 0
drwxr-xr-x  2 root root      60 Jul 23 16:26 .
drwxr-xr-x 13 root root    3.7K Jul 23 16:27 ..
crw-rw-rw-  1 root root 10, 200 Jul 23 16:26 tun

But when I try to start OpenVPN it throws an error:

debarm:/dev/net# openvpn /root/2738.ovpn

Thu Jul 23 16:29:42 2015 Note: Cannot open TUN/TAP dev /dev/net/tun: No such device (errno=19)
Thu Jul 23 16:29:42 2015 Note: Attempting fallback to kernel 2.2 TUN/TAP interface
Thu Jul 23 16:29:42 2015 Cannot allocate TUN/TAP dev dynamically
Thu Jul 23 16:29:42 2015 Exiting

Equally, if I try to modprobe it, I get an error, however I think that's to do with the fact tun is now compiled in rather than a kernal module

debarm:/dev/net# modprobe tun
FATAL: Module tun not found.

Could someone hopefully suggest a reason why this might be the case, and ideally a solution! :-)

Thanks!

1 Answer 1

0

Existence of file: /dev/net/tun (character device) is not equal to existence of kernel module called 'tun'.

Solution: add tun device to kernel configuration and recompile the kernel.

Check current module state: lsmod | grep tun.

2
  • Yup, that pretty much sums it up. Unfortunately the kernel provided with the board (FoxBoard G20 for anyone who wants to know) doesn't come with the tun kernel module. A kernel recompile for all 40 boards was out of the question so we've made do with reverse tunnels for now. Jul 30, 2015 at 1:06
  • You don't need to do kernel recompilation on all devices, you need to do it on one of them and then copy necessary changes: - kernel, initrd (if exist) and modules to others. Sep 12, 2015 at 10:56
